These Mocha Muffins are a perfect balance of flavours, from the chocolate and coffee. The first time I baked these muffins, using instant coffee, we could not taste the coffee at all. Second time round I brewed some strong coffee and it worked well. I’ve also used espresso coffee and it tastes awesome.

When it comes to coffee, Kenya is blessed with some awesome aromatic coffee that grows on the Highlands. The rich volcanic soil and high rainfall is best for the Arabica variety.

What is Mocha?

Though Mocha means different things in different parts of the world, basically mocha is a shot of espresso with chocolate powder or chocolate syrup. Either milk or cream is added to it.

It is believed that the drink is named after the mocha coffee bean. These beans are shipped from Al Mokka in Yemen. These coffee beans naturally have a chocolatey flavour. However, these days mocha is a drink not necessarily from the mocha bean but a coffee with chocolate.

 

Ingredients Required For Mocha Muffins

  • Wheat Flour – I’ve used normal wheat flour (atta) that I use for making roti. You can use wheat pastry flour. Can replace wheat flour with plain or all purpose flour. However, reduce the liquid by 2 -3 tbsp.
  • Cocoa Powder – unsweetened
  • Brewed Coffee – make the coffee strong or use espresso. Allow the brewed coffee to cool down. Or alternately, add ground coffee to ½ cup cold water. Leave the mixture overnight. Next day strain and use the cold brewed coffee.
  • Cinnamon Powder
  • Soda Bicarbonate – baking soda
  • Salt – don’t add if you use salted butter.
  • Unsalted Butter – take 1 stick or 113g. Melt it. I melted it in the microwave oven.
  • Brown Sugar – or powdered jaggery
  • White Sugar – granulated. Or substitute with brown sugar.
  • Egg – large. If you don’t want to use egg then replace it with ¼ cup plain thick yogurt.
  • Milk – I have used dairy milk. Can replace it with whipping cream.
  • Yogurt – thick plain yogurt. Make sure it is not watery.
  • Walnuts – chopped. Can replace with any other nuts of your choice.
  • Semi sweet chocolate chips – or use any dark chocolate and chop it up into small pieces.
  • Vanilla Extract

MOCHA MUFFINS

mayurisjikoni
Mocha Muffins are moist, coffee flavoured, full of walnuts and choco chips with a crusty top. Perfect muffins to enjoy with your morning coffee or as an afternoon snack.

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 35 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Course Breakfast, Dessert, Snack
Cuisine International
Servings 6 PIECES

Ingredients
  

  • cups wheat flour
  • ½ tsp cinnamon powder
  • 1 tsp soda bicarbonate
  • ¼ tsp salt
  • ¼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• ½ cup white sugar
  • ½ cup brown sugar
  • ½ cup walnuts chopped
  • ¼ cup semi sweet choco chips
  • cup espresso or strong coffee cold
  • 1 large egg
  • ½ cup milk
  • ¼ cup plain yogurt thick
  • ½ cup unsalted butter melted
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 180C.
  • Sift flour, soda bicarbonate, cocoa powder, salt and cinnamon powder together into a mixing bowl.
  • Take another mixing bowl. Add the sugars, coffee, egg, milk, yogurt, melted butter and vanilla extract.
  • Whisk lightly to mix.
  •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ients.
  • Mix just enough till the flour is incorporated into the wet ingredients. Don’t over mix.
  • Fold in the chopped nuts and choco chips.
  • Fill cake cups with the batter, three quarter of the way.
  • Use large or medium ones. If you use large ones, you will get 6-7 muffins. If you use medium ones you will get 12 muffins.
  • Bake large muffins for 30-35 minutes and medium ones for 20-25 minutes.
  • Insert a toothpick or small knife in the middle of a muffin. It should come out clean if the muffins are baked.
  • Remove the muffins from the oven.
  • Allow them to cool on a wire rack.

Notes

  • If you use large cake cups like I have then you'll get 6-7 muffins. If you use medium cake cups then you'll get 12 muffins.
  • Baking time will vary according to the size of the cake cups you use.
  • Replace nuts with chocolate chips.
  • To replace the egg for eggless version add ¼ cup plain yogurt.
  • If you use plain or all purpose flour then reduce milk to ⅓ cup.
